Here are our top 10 tips for safety during black mold removal.
1. Dust Masks
Dust masks are an essential part of the kit; they prevent any inhalation of the mold spores. A respirator is ideal but also expensive, so a dust mask will suffice as long as it is of good quality.

2. Protective Clothing
Clothing that covered all exposed skin should be worn at all times. Ideal made of a fabric that is easy to wipe down and clean or be binned afterword. Tyvek suits are perfect but not necessary.
3. Goggles & Ear Plugs
Wear goggles and ear plugs to prevent mold spores entering places that are almost impossible to clean.
4. Remove Pets & Family Members
Evacuate the house of any family pets or loved ones. Anyone who is not involved in the cleaning process is at risk during the clean-up operation. Anyone with health conditions such not be helping with the clean-up as an added precaution.
5. Have Plenty of Breaks
Black Mold clean-up can take hours or even days. Be sure to have plenty of breaks and time for fresh air to ensure your renewed health through out. Any feels of dizziness or shortness of breath should be treated with respect and immediate removal from the environment is recommended.
6. Removal of Materials
All cleaning products and contaminated materials should be taken out in sealed heavy-duty plastic packaging to ensure it doesn’t contaminated further areas.
7. Prevent the Spread
All items used in the clean up should be properly cleaned also before exiting the area. Clothing should be removed, and placed in a sealed area until it can be cleaned separately form other clothing.
8. Air Purifiers
Use air purifier during and for a short time after the clean up to maximize the removal of any mold spores in the atmosphere.
9. Seal Off The Contaminated Area
Use plastic sheeting and duct tape the seal the area off to prevent the mold seeping out of doorways or ventilations systems and contaminating other rooms of the building.
10. Dry Out the Area
After cleaning ensure the area is dry to prevent another build up of mold.
